"The problem of discipline in schools is something that has been studied for quite some time. It became significant originally in the 1980s, but the issue has continued to progress. Some students are having discipline problems at very high rates today, and it is believed that the way that these students are disciplined may have something to do with whether they are 'learning their lesson' when they do get into trouble for something, or whether they do not see the disciplinary process as being effective enough to cause them to modify their behavior.
Recent interviews with teachers have indicated that the discipline problems that they see in their middle school classrooms today are worse than they have ever seen in the past (Colavecchio & Miller, 2002). Naturally, this is a concern. This problem is indicative not only of the fact that discipline problems are on the rise, but also indicative of the fact that the problems that students have with discipline are beginning to manifest themselves at younger ages. These problems are seen with all types of students, including those that are in gifted classrooms where discipline would not be thought to be a problem (Smutny, 2000)."
